What is EUR/USD on MT4?
EUR/USD spread is the difference between the buy and sell price of the currency pair, essentially your cost per trade. For Czech Republic traders, this cost is magnified because your profits are in USD but your real spending power is in CZK. For example, if EUR/USD moves 0.1 pip, on a 0.01 lot trade that equals approximately 0.10 USD. At an exchange rate of 24 CZK per USD, that is 2.40 CZK per 0.1 pip — a small but real cost that adds up. Why does spread matter more for Czech Republic traders? Because local trading volumes may be lower, and broker options that accept CZK deposits often have wider spreads or additional conversion fees. ECN spreads are almost always better for Czech Republic traders given the 1:30 leverage cap, because every pip saved directly improves your risk-to-reward ratio. A trader from Prague making 100 trades per month with a 0.2 pip spread versus a 1.0 pip spread saves 80 pips × 10 USD per pip on a standard lot = 800 USD, which is roughly 19,200 CZK per month. The CNB does not mandate specific spread disclosures, but reputable brokers voluntarily publish them. For Czech Republic traders, choosing a broker with verified low spreads is essential to protect your CZK-denominated capital.
Best trading times - EUR/USD from Czech Republic
For Czech Republic traders (UTC+2), the EUR/USD market offers excellent timing. The London session opens at 10:00 local time — you do not need to wake up early or stay up late; you can trade during normal business hours. The best spreads occur during the NY-London overlap from 15:00 to 18:30 local time, when liquidity peaks. A recommended routine for Czech Republic traders: check your charts at 10:00 local when London opens, set up potential trades, and execute during the overlap for the tightest spreads. The Asian session runs from approximately 22:00 local to 07:00 local the next day — spreads can widen significantly during this period, so Czech Republic traders should avoid scalping during those hours. Also note that Czech Republic public holidays (e.g., May 1, July 5-6) do not affect forex trading, but the market still closes on weekends. Always plan your trades around the London and overlap sessions for the best EUR/USD execution from Czech Republic.

Execution & slippage - Czech Republic
Czech Republic boasts excellent internet infrastructure, with average broadband speeds exceeding 25 Mbps and low latency to European financial hubs. For Czech Republic traders, the recommended server location is London (Equinix LD4 or LD5), which typically yields ping times of 20-30 milliseconds from Prague or Brno. This is more than adequate for most trading styles, including scalping. However, for high-frequency scalping on EUR/USD, a VPS hosted in the same London data center as your broker's servers can reduce latency to under 5 ms. Among brokers, XM Group offers the best execution for Czech Republic traders, with dedicated servers in London and no requotes on market orders. Slippage on EUR/USD during the London-New York overlap is typically less than 0.1 pip for Czech Republic traders using ECN accounts. Always use a wired internet connection or a VPS to minimize slippage, especially when trading news events. CNB does not regulate execution quality, so choose a broker with a strong reputation for fast fills.
Islamic accounts & swap fees - Czech Republic
Czech Republic is not a Muslim-majority country — less than 0.2% of the population identifies as Muslim, so Islamic accounts are rarely requested locally. However, for those who do require them, XM Group and Exness offer genuine swap-free accounts with no hidden admin fees. For a Czech Republic trader with a $1,000 account at 1:30 leverage holding a 0.1 lot EUR/USD position overnight, the swap cost is approximately -0.25 USD per night (long position, depending on interest rates), which equals about 6 CZK per night. Over a month (22 trading days), that is 132 CZK — a noticeable cost. To minimize swap costs, Czech Republic traders should close positions before the rollover time (typically 23:00 local UTC+2). For non-Muslim traders, using a swap-free account is not recommended as it may incur higher spreads or commissions. Always check the swap rates in your broker's platform before holding positions overnight.
